반응형

1. 문제 번호 2753번


 

2. 한 줄 키워드 

 

2.1 계산 하는 방식을 간단히 해야한다. (문제를 정확히 이해하고 복잡한 삼항 연산자보다 간단하게 나타내기) 


3. 소스 인증

import java.util.*;
import java.lang.*;
import java.io.*;

/**********************

Writer : KTH
Purpose: 

**********************/

public class Main {
	public static void main(String[] args) throws IOException {
 
        B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
        
        int year = Integer.parseInt(br.readLine());
        int yearName = 0;

        if ( (year%4 == 0 && year%100 !=0) || ((year%400==0) && !(year%100==0 &&year%400!=0)) ){
            yearName = 1;
        }

        System.out.print(yearName);    
        
	}
}

 

 

import java.util.*;
import java.lang.*;
import java.io.*;

/**********************

Writer : KTH
Purpose: 

**********************/

public class Main {
	public static void main(String[] args) throws IOException {
 
        B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
        
        int year = Integer.parseInt(br.readLine());
        int yearName = 0;

        if ((year % 4 == 0 && year % 100 != 0) || (year % 400 == 0)) {
            System.out.println("1"); // 윤년
        } else {
            System.out.println("0"); // 윤년이 아님
        }

        // System.out.print(year%4 == 0 ? (year%400 == 0 ? "1" : (year%100 ==0) ? "0" : "1" ) :"0");
        
	}
}

4. 추가 개념

 

 

 

 

 

 

728x90
반응형

'알고리즘(BOJ) 문제풀이' 카테고리의 다른 글

[BOJ/백준] 조건문_2525  (0) 2024.05.07
[BOJ/백준] 조건문_14681  (0) 2024.05.03
[BOJ/백준] 조건문_9498  (0) 2024.05.03
[BOJ/백준] 조건문_1330번  (0) 2024.05.03
[BOJ/백준] 입출력과 사칙연산_10172번  (0) 2024.05.03

+ Recent posts